Charles Bonds, who was issued a citation while protesting last fall at the Bloomington Community Farmers’ Market, voices his opposition to changing the agenda lineup Feb. 25 at the Bloomington Board of Park Commissioners meeting in City Hall. The board voted 2-1 to implement changes to the farmers market rules, which define the areas of the market where protesters are permitted.
